Local Organizing Map

Overview

ControlShift's local organizing map shows all of your organization's events and groups in one place. We think of the local organizing map as the big front door through which your supporters can find opportunities to get involved in their local communities.   

Organizations can access their local organizing map by adding /local to their platform's URL. For example: https://demo.controlshiftlabs.com/local.

The local organizing map will include all of your organization's Approved listed groups and all upcoming events that have been moderated to Good. If your organization is using MobilizeAmerica or EveryAction, it's also possible to include events from those systems on ControlShift's local organizing map. 

When someone searches for their location, we'll automatically zoom the map (and filter the event list in the sidebar) to show the events and groups that are closest to their entered location. 

There are various filters available for searches. Users can choose to include only events or groups, can choose to exclude virtual events, and search for specific event types or labels from the filters list directly below the search box.

External (Ingested) Events

We want this local organizing map to serve as a single point of entry for supporters who want to get involved in the work your organization is doing. To that end, the local organizing map can also include information about your organization's events in MobilizeAmerica and/or NGPVAN/EveryAction. 

These external events will initially look like native events to your supporters. We'll include information about these events' times, dates, and locations in the sidebar listing of events. Physical events from these third-party systems will also be plotted on the map. 

When users search for their location, external events will be included in the search results and in filtered lists. These events will not appear any differently than native ControlShift events. When a user clicks to RSVP to an external event, they'll be sent to that third-party site to complete their RSVP.

To start pulling external events onto the map, follow the instructions for NGPVAN/EveryAction and MobilizeAmerica

Embeds

In addition to sending people the local organizing map page, it's also possible to embed the map (with or without the sidebar) or just the list of events and groups  on external sites. To get started go to the org admin homepage > Settings > Local Map. From that page you can choose what should be included in the embed and copy the embed code.
